Join us at this year's final Cascade Head work party! After a moderate hike of 2 miles with 500 feet of elevation gain, we will work with hand tools (shovels, mattocks, loppers) to remove invasive blackberry plant roots in priority areas. Working on the site will involve maneuvering around with tools on some uneven and somewhat steep terrain. Some volunteers may help with the lighter duty tasks of cleaning off moss and dirt from the trail’s fiberglass footbridges.
The work will end around 2:45 p.m., and we will hike back down to the trailhead at Knight County Park. Starting at 3:30 p.m., we will hold a volunteer appreciation celebration at Knight Park with light snacks, pie and a raffle for gifts. All volunteers who helped at Cascade Head this year will be invited for the celebration.
